The first Machine Automated IQ Test Challenge (MAIQ) at IJCAI’2020

AI benchmarking becomes an increasingly important task for the rapid development of AI research. Meaningful AI benchmarks, such as ImageNet and RoboCup not only provide a standard testbed for comparing different AI approaches, but also significantly promote and stimulate AI research.

As one of the predominant benchmarks for measuring human intelligence, Intelligence Quotient (IQ) test provides a natural and excellent AI benchmark for testing the current development of AI research. For better solving IQ tests automatedly by machines, one needs to use, combine and advance many areas in AI including knowledge representation and reasoning, machine learning, natural language processing and image understanding.

The IJCAI-2020 Machine Automated IQ Test Challenge (MAIQ’2020) contains three categories including verbal comprehension, diagram reasoning and sequence reasoning, all questions are collected from genuine IQ Test questions for human being. By given a SDK and some dataset, participants are required to develop programs to solve these problems automatically.

==== Overview ====
The Journal Track is designed to provide a forum to discuss important results related to cognitive and developmental systems recently published as journal articles, but have not been previously presented as conference papers. Thus, the journal track offers an opportunity to present outstanding results that might otherwise not be submitted to a conference due to their length and complexity.

All accepted journal presentations will be selected for either oral or poster presentation during the conference based on the reviews – at least one author is expected to register to ICDL 2020 and to present the paper in person.

*** Aim & Scope ***

The international summer school VISMAC "VISione delle MACchine" (in English, "Machine Vision") is organized every two years by the "Associazione Italiana per la ricerca in Computer Vision, Pattern recognition e machine Learning" (CVPL – ex-GIRPR) affiliated to International Association for Pattern Recognition (IAPR). It represents a stimulating opportunity for doctoral students, young researchers from universities, research institutions and industry. The primary objective of the Summer School is to provide a common scientific and cultural background on the subjects of computer vision and pattern recognition.

This edition of VISMAC will mainly focus on four renowned research topics: Bio-imaging, Automotive, Cultural Heritage, Image forensics.

1. Summary and Scope
In the machine learning and computer vision fields, due to the rapid development of deep learning, recent years have witnessed breakthroughs for large-sample classification tasks. However, it remains a persistent challenge to learn a deep neural network with good generalizability from only a small number of training samples. In fact, humans can easily learn the concept of a class from a small amount of data rather than from millions of data. Moreover, many types of real-world data are small in quantity and are expensive to collect or label. Motivated by this fact, research on deep learning with small samples becomes more and more prevalent in the communities of machine learning and computer vision, for example, researches focusing on one-shot classification, few-shot classification, as well as classification with small training samples.
Recently, deep small-sample learning has achieved promising performance for certain small-sample problems, by transferring the “knowledge” learned from other datasets containing rich labelled data or generating synthetic samples to approximate the distribution of real data. However, many challenging topics remain with small-sample deep leaning techniques, such as data augmentation, feature learning, prior construction, meta-learning, and fine tuning. Therefore, the goal of this special issue is to collect and publish the latest developments in various aspects of deep learning with small samples.
